Tell us about your background?
I was born in Hong Kong. As a child I loved drawing and painting from an early age. Studied and Worked Design for over 17 years specializing in Mode Illustration, Multimedia applications and Design. Have been active in design and illustration for advertisements, editorial, comics, fashion, stationery, toys, and websites. I founded my own brand “Asteria” in 2003. Products released from the Asteria brand launched since the summer of 2003. I now work for corporate, product and editorial clients around the world. Clients including Japan, USA, Germany and Hong Kong.

Have you had artistic studies and was it useful for you?
Mainly studied in Art and Design for 7 years in an Art College. On completion of the course, I took a Course on Visual Communication. These courses has provided me a thorough education in color sense, hand drawing skill and computer knowledge.

How would you explain your style of illustration?
My uniquely style is to create fairytale imagery, that can be seen throughout my website. It mixes fantacy, glamour and sensuous “baby-dolls” styles. Figures are iconed with big starry-eyed icons displaying super cuteness.
The character Asteria is the darling star for some of the fashion illustrations.


What programs do you use to create your illustrations?
I produce images in Adobe Photoshop or Illustrator, sometimes combined with more traditional fine art media.

What are your creation processes?
All of my illustrations are sketched by hand, scanned and finished digitally in Adobe Illustrator and Adobe Photoshop.
